We’re looking for a full-time Legal Assistant to support our Philadelphia, PA office. This is a in office position for our General Liability team.
Primary responsibilities include:
Primary Job Duties:
- Finalizing and serving documents including pleadings, discovery, motions, letter correspondence, etc.
- Organization of case files; gathering, organizing and analyzing data
- Ideal candidate must be highly organized, detail-oriented and able to handle multiple tasks simultaneously.
- Works closely with attorneys and in-office billing department including accounts receivable
- Organize, chart and process incoming records and invoices
- Follow up for outstanding records via telephone, e-mail and regular mail
- Organization of case files; gathering, organizing and analyzing data
- Prepare Affidavits of Service and facilitate outgoing documents to the Court and to adversaries
- Prepare court filings; and e-filing
Requirements:
- Candidates must have a minimum of 2 years' legal experience
- Candidates must have experience in preparing and serving documents
- Proficiency in Microsoft Outlook as well as other Microsoft Office applications including Word, Excel, and PDF creation and searches
- Familiarity with and prior use of ProLaw and/or iManage is a plus
